告别淘汰命运:开源工具如何让旧设备焕发第二春
在科技快速迭代的时代,大量性能尚可的旧设备因系统版本限制而被束之高阁。旧设备升级并非简单的系统更新,而是通过开源解决方案实现硬件适配的复杂工程。本文将深入剖析老旧硬件面临的系统升级困境,介绍如何利用开源工具突破限制,为旧设备注入新活力,重新定义其使用价值。
剖析淘汰困境:旧设备面临的系统升级壁垒
厂商限制的技术枷锁
苹果等硬件厂商通过多重技术手段限制旧设备升级新系统,主要包括处理器指令集门槛、驱动程序支持 cutoff 和安全机制限制。这些限制如同给旧设备戴上了无形的枷锁,使其无法发挥真正的硬件潜力。
硬件潜力的认知误区
许多用户误认为旧设备无法运行新系统是因为硬件性能不足,实则不然。2012-2016年间生产的Mac设备多数搭载了Haswell、Broadwell或Skylake架构处理器,硬件性能足以支撑新系统运行,只是被软件限制所束缚。
硬件潜力评估雷达图
| 评估维度 | 最低要求 | 2012-2013年设备 | 2014-2016年设备 |
|---|---|---|---|
| 处理器架构 | Intel Core i5 | ★★★☆☆ | ★★★★☆ |
| 内存容量 | 8GB RAM | ★★☆☆☆ | ★★★★☆ |
| 存储性能 | SATA SSD | ★★★☆☆ | ★★★★☆ |
| 图形能力 | Intel HD4000 | ★★☆☆☆ | ★★★☆☆ |
| 扩展性 | 可升级组件 | ★★★★☆ | ★★☆☆☆ |
重构硬件价值:开源工具的创新解决方案
启动引导的智能翻译
OpenCore Legacy Patcher作为开源解决方案的代表,通过在系统启动时动态修改关键参数,充当老Mac与新系统之间的"翻译官"。它在启动过程中拦截硬件信息,将其转换为新系统可识别的格式,同时提供缺失的驱动支持,实现无缝兼容。
OpenCore Legacy Patcher主界面提供直观的功能选择,包括构建安装OpenCore、创建macOS安装器和后期根补丁等核心功能
动态补丁的工作原理
该工具采用内存级动态补丁技术,不会永久修改系统文件。所有适配工作都在启动过程中临时完成,就像给旧设备发放了一张临时"访问通行证",既实现了新系统运行,又保留了恢复原始状态的可能。
实施复杂度-收益平衡矩阵
| 设备类型 | 实施复杂度 | 性能提升 | 功能完整性 | 推荐指数 |
|---|---|---|---|---|
| 2015-2016年设备 | ★★☆☆☆ | ★★★★☆ | ★★★★☆ | ★★★★★ |
| 2013-2014年设备 | ★★★☆☆ | ★★★☆☆ | ★★★☆☆ | ★★★★☆ |
| 2012年设备 | ★★★★☆ | ★★☆☆☆ | ★★☆☆☆ | ★★★☆☆ |
| 2011年及以前 | ★★★★★ | ★☆☆☆☆ | ★☆☆☆☆ | ★★☆☆☆ |
绘制实施蓝图:四步完成旧设备系统升级
准备升级环境
首先需要评估设备硬件状态,确保至少8GB内存和60GB可用存储空间。备份重要数据后,准备一个32GB以上的USB驱动器作为安装介质。通过以下命令获取工具:
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
构建定制安装介质
选择"Create macOS Installer"功能,工具会自动下载适合的macOS版本或使用本地安装文件。插入USB驱动器并选择为目标设备,等待工具完成安装介质创建。
安装器创建成功后,系统会提示可以将OpenCore安装到该驱动器
安装引导程序
返回主菜单选择"Build and Install OpenCore",工具会分析硬件并生成最佳配置。点击"Install to disk"并选择目标磁盘的EFI分区——设备启动时的"系统引导区",输入管理员密码完成安装。
OpenCore配置构建完成后,可立即安装到目标磁盘的EFI分区
应用硬件补丁
选择"Post-Install Root Patch"功能,工具会扫描系统并确定需要的硬件补丁。点击开始按钮,等待补丁应用完成后重启电脑使补丁生效。
根补丁应用完成后,系统会提示重启以激活所有硬件驱动
构建决策矩阵:评估升级可行性
兼容性检测清单
| 检查项目 | 最低要求 | 注意事项 |
|---|---|---|
| 设备型号 | 2012年及以后 | 可在"关于本机"中查看 |
| 硬件健康 | 硬盘无坏道 | 使用磁盘工具检查SMART状态 |
| 电池状况 | 健康状态>80% | 旧电池可能需要更换 |
| 技术准备 | 基本命令行操作能力 | 需理解EFI分区概念 |
风险收益评估
| 潜在风险 | 影响程度 | 发生概率 | 应对策略 |
|---|---|---|---|
| 数据丢失 | 高 | 低 | 提前完整备份所有数据 |
| 系统不稳定 | 中 | 中 | 选择稳定版而非最新版macOS |
| 功能缺失 | 低 | 中 | 查阅社区设备兼容性报告 |
| 无法启动 | 高 | 低 | 准备可引导的恢复介质 |
优化升级策略:提升系统运行体验
系统性能优化
成功升级后,通过减少视觉效果、管理启动项和调整能源设置来提升系统响应速度。特别建议升级SSD存储,这对旧设备性能提升最为显著。
长期维护方案
定期更新OpenCore Legacy Patcher以获取最新补丁,使用系统维护工具清理缓存,并监控硬件温度避免过热问题。建立系统快照,便于在出现问题时快速恢复。
资源导航卡
- 项目仓库:通过git clone获取最新版本
- 兼容性数据库:docs/MODELS.md
- 社区支持:项目讨论区和用户论坛
- 详细文档:docs/目录下的教程和指南
通过开源工具赋能老旧硬件,不仅是一项技术实践,更是一种可持续的科技消费理念。让每一台设备都能发挥最大潜能,延长使用寿命,既环保又经济。现在就评估你的旧设备,给它一个重获新生的机会吧!真正的科技价值不在于频繁更换,而在于物尽其用。
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
atomcodeAn open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ust029
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
ERNIE-ImageERNIE-Image 是由百度 ERNIE-Image 团队开发的开源文本到图像生成模型。它基于单流扩散 Transformer(DiT)构建,并配备了轻量级的提示增强器,可将用户的简短输入扩展为更丰富的结构化描述。凭借仅 80 亿的 DiT 参数,它在开源文本到图像模型中达到了最先进的性能。该模型的设计不仅追求强大的视觉质量,还注重实际生成场景中的可控性,在这些场景中,准确的内容呈现与美观同等重要。特别是,ERNIE-Image 在复杂指令遵循、文本渲染和结构化图像生成方面表现出色,使其非常适合商业海报、漫画、多格布局以及其他需要兼具视觉质量和精确控制的内容创作任务。它还支持广泛的视觉风格,包括写实摄影、设计导向图像以及更多风格化的美学输出。Jinja00



